    Elizabeth Olsen thinks about deleting Instagram "every day"

    The 'Captain America: Civil War' star considers erasing her account on the photo sharing site every single day as she "doesn't know why she's on it"


    She told Harper's Bazaar magazine: "Every day I think I should delete it. I still don’t know why I’m on it, then I think well 'I guess I want to promote Avengers' and then I find myself putting something private up there and I think, 'this is stupid, why did I do that? I should delete it immediately.'"

    Meanwhile, Elizabeth previously admitted she avoids social media.

    She said: "I just have an old-school mindset. Also, girls I look up to, like Jennifer Lawrence, Rooney Mara and Alicia Vikander, don’t have it, and it hasn’t affected their careers remotely ... I’d rather live as private a life as I can. I’m not trying to be a mysterious person, but I’d rather be seen as an actor from job to job. I’ve never lived my life trying to be an influencer; I’m happy keeping my own opinions for fun dinner conversation ... A lot of the time in my life, I try not to take up space - I just want to disappear into a wall. And then eventually, when I’m around people I feel confident with, I’ll take up more space."

    Elizabeth had considered quitting acting at one point in her life.

    She told BANG Showbiz: "When I was nine or 10, I contemplated quitting acting, so it wasn’t a real thing ... I think those people are completely separate. When I was a little girl, I didn’t want to work as a child actress but as an adult I always wanted to be an actress, so I am thankful for every job."
